What is the ADIPOQ gene?
ADIPOQ influences adiponectin-related signaling, which helps shape insulin sensitivity, fatty-acid handling, and broader metabolic flexibility.
How ADIPOQ affects metabolism
If ADIPOQ-related signaling is less favorable, the system may become less resilient around insulin response and fat handling. That can make metabolism feel less forgiving under stress or inconsistent habits.
What happens when ADIPOQ is altered
Altered ADIPOQ function does not create a diagnosis on its own, but it can make insulin-sensitivity follow-up more relevant than generic body-composition advice.

Biomarkers to validate
Fasting insulin
Useful for checking whether insulin-related pressure is already visible.
Triglycerides
Adds context when insulin sensitivity and lipid handling overlap.
HbA1c
Helpful for longer-term glucose context.
